Adel Bettaieb, the 29-year-old Tunisian forward who netted 11 goals in the previous season for FC Argeș, has ended his contract with the Romanian club and rejected an offer to extend his stay. Instead, he has agreed to join a Chinese team, marking a significant departure for the player and the club.
The move comes as no surprise to FC Argeș president Dani Coman, who confirmed that Bettaieb had chosen to continue his career in China, where he will earn a monthly salary of €40,000. While the Romanian club had offered Bettaieb a substantial salary, it was clear that the player was attracted to the Chinese offer.
Bettaieb’s Decision: A New Chapter in China
Bettaieb arrived at FC Argeș in the summer of 2025, following his departure from U Cluj. During his time with the “Trivale” team, the Tunisian forward established himself as a key player, netting 11 goals and providing two assists in 38 Superliga appearances. His impressive form caught the attention of Chinese clubs, and it’s no surprise that he has opted for a move to the Far East.
A Brief but Eventful Career
Before joining FC Argeș, Bettaieb had played for several clubs, including Angers, Dudelange, Umraniyespor, and Boluspor. His most recent stint was with Poli Iași, where he scored four goals and provided one assist in 17 Superliga appearances before leaving for U Cluj in 2024. Despite struggling to make an impact at U Cluj, Bettaieb’s talent and experience have made him a sought-after player in the transfer market, with a reported valuation of €900,000.
